On Sat, Jun 14, 2003 at 12:06:50AM +0300, Ruslan Ermilov wrote: > > Stop in /usr/src/secure/usr.bin/openssl. > > *** Error code 1 > > > This means that either /usr/obj/usr/src/secure/usr.bin/openssl > or /usr/src/secure/usr.bin/openssl have the "openssl" file, > where it's supposed to be a directory in /usr/obj/...
... > > rm -r /usr/obj/usr/src/secure/usr.bin/openssl Oh, I really did not think about it ! I should know that "make clean" would remove _object_ files, not source ! sigh! ;( Good, on next monday I'll try it ;) > Note that "make clean" is only guaranteed to work if the > object tree was populated using this same sources; everything > else is not guaranteed to work, and "make cleandir" is > advised instead, though even this may break when the types > of some files change from "file" to "directory", like has > happened with /usr/obj/usr/src/secure/usr.bin/openssl/openssl. ah ok.
